Weber State Football Is No. 7 in HERO Sports Preseason Rankings

OGDEN, Utah-Thursday, Weber State football achieved a No. 7 ranking in the HERO Sports preseason poll.

The Wildcats are tied for No. 7 with fellow Big Sky Conference foe Montana State.

Other Big Sky Conference schools to be ranked include No. 9 Montana, No. 16 Eastern Washington and No. 23 Sacramento State.

Defending national champion Sam Houston is No. 1 in the polls, followed by No. 2 James Madison No. 3 South Dakota State, No. 4 North Dakota State and No. 5 Southern Illinois.

The Wildcats went 5-1 during the spring season and made the NCAA FCS playoffs for the fifth consecutive season.

The reigning Big Sky Coach of the Year Jay Hill returns for his eighth season in leading the Wildcats’ program.

Weber State is represented by four All-Americans: senior linebacker Conner Mortensen, the reigning Big Sky Conference defensive MVP, senior kick returner Rashid Shaheed, senior safety Preston Smith and senior offensive lineman Ty Whitworth.

The Wildcats also return 13 All-Big Sky Conference performers from the spring season.

Weber State commences fall camp August 4 and will start the season September 2 at Utah.

The Wildcats’ home opener at Stewart Stadium is September 18 against national power James Madison.
